/*
   Dinamic / Inder arcade hardware

   Mega Phoenix
   Hammer Boy

 also known to exist on this hardware:
   Nonamed 2 (ever finished? only code seen has 1991 date and is vastly incomplete) (versions exist for Amstrad CPC, MSX and Spectrum)
   After The War



  trivia: Test mode graphics are the same as Little Robin(?!), TMS is very similar too, suggesting they share a common codebase.

 PIC16C54 info:
 - The PIC has 5 functions:
   * Read dip switches (serially connected) [cmd 0x82 0x86]
   * Read the two start buttons [returned with all commands]
   * Provide 4 security codes. For the dumped PIC those are:
     0x4a 0x6f 0x61 0x6e (Joan). Not used by Mega Phoenix. [cmd 0x8a 0x8e 0x92 0x96]
   * Watchdog enable. Not used by Mega Phoenix. [cmd 9a]
   * Provide PIC software version to the game. This is 0x11 here. [all other cmds]
 - Communication with the game is achieved using a 8255 PPI on port C that is
   connected serially to the PIC. For port assignments see the code below.
 - The game sends an 8-bit command. After each bit, the PIC sends an answer bit.
   The start buttons are always bits 2 and 3 here.
 - All sent commands look like this: 1ccccc10
 - After the command was received, the PIC will send an additional 8 bits
   with the result.

  --


  Chips of note

  Main board:

  TS68000CP8
  TMS34010FNL-40
  TMP82C55AP-2

  Bt478KPJ35  Palette / RAMDAC

  Actel A1010A-PL68C  (custom blitter maybe?)

  2x 8 DSW, bottom corner, away from everything..

 Sub / Sound board:

  ST Z8430AB1

  custom INDER badged chip 40 pin?  (probably just a z80 - it's in the sound section)
    MODELO: MEGA PHOENIX
    KIT NO. 1.034
    FECHA FABRICACION 08.10.91
    LA MANIPULCION DE LA ETIQUETA O DE LA PLACA ANULA SU SARANTIA
    (this sticker is also present on the other PCB)
